Fla. FFs Hit House Fire

Jan. 25, 2010
  OCALA, FLA.. -- Ocala Fire Rescue responded to a house fire which resulted in one resident being transported to the hospital for smoke inhalation. The fire occurred at 2014 Southwest 5 St. Firefighters responded at 10:32 a.m. to find heavy smoke coming from the one-story concrete block house. The resident on the front lawn. He told fire officials he returned home to find the house on fire, and entered the dwelling breathing in some smoke. Firefighters quickly extinguished the fire, although there was extensive damage throughout the house from smoke and fire.
